US Secretary of State Marco Rubio expressed hope that after the meeting between the US and Ukrainian delegations in Florida, further progress will be made in resolving the conflict in Ukraine. The politician told reporters about this at the beginning of the meeting with the Ukrainian side.

“We expect even greater progress today,” he was quoted as saying.

According to Rubio, Kyiv has huge economic potential and huge opportunities for prosperity. But clearly, this cannot be achieved in the context of military conflict, the US Secretary of State said.

Kiev and Washington Agree The main issues the plan addresses in the Geneva negotiations are the lack of agreement on territory and security guarantees.

Then Secretary of the National Security and Defense Council (NSDC) of Ukraine Rustem Umerov reportedthat the Ukrainian delegation is coming to the US to participate in the negotiation process.

From the US side, Rubio, US President Donald Trump's special envoy Steven Witkoff and US leader's son-in-law Jared Kushner are participating in negotiations. According to media reports, during the meeting, Washington hoped reach Ukraine's consent on territorial issues and security guarantees.
